《電子技術應用》
您所在的位置:首頁 > 模擬設計 > 設計應用 > 基于X-Linear和語義嵌入的視頻描述算法
基于X-Linear和語義嵌入的視頻描述算法
信息技術與網絡安全
李亞杰,關勝曉,倪長好
(中國科學技術大學 微電子學院,安徽 合肥230026)
摘要: 注意力機制和視頻語義嵌入使得視頻描述任務取得了顯著的提升,為更好地利用時序動態(tài)特征和語義信息,提出一種基于X-Linear的語義嵌入視頻描述算法(X-Linear Semantic Embedding Network,XLSNet)。該算法以基于編碼解碼器網絡為基礎,使用X-Linear注意力模塊對視頻特征進行編碼,該模塊使用雙線性池化來增加視頻時序特征的高階交互,最終提取豐富的時序動態(tài)特征;為充分利用視頻語義信息,使用語義嵌入的GRU和X-Linear作為解碼器對視頻描述進行生成。為防止過擬合現象,對解碼器的GRU使用了層歸一化和變分Dropout。所提出的算法僅僅使用了視頻幀特征,在公開視頻描述數據集MSVD上取得了很好的效果。
中圖分類號: TP183
文獻標識碼: A
DOI: 10.19358/j.issn.2096-5133.2021.02.008
引用格式: 李亞杰,關勝曉,倪長好. 基于X-Linear和語義嵌入的視頻描述算法[J].信息技術與網絡安全,2021,40(2):45-51.
Video caption algorithm based on X-Linear and semantic embedding
Li Yajie,Guan Shengxiao,Ni Changhao
(School of Microelectronics,University of Science and Technology of China,Hefei 230026,China)
Abstract: The attention mechanism and video semantic embedding have significantly improved the video description task.In order to make better use of the temporal dynamic features and semantic information of the video,a X-Linear-based semantic embedding video description algorithm(X-Linear Semantic Embedding Network,XLSNet) is proposed. The algorithm is based on a encoder-decoder network and uses the X-Linear attention block to encode video features. This block uses bilinear pooling to increase the high-order interaction of video temporal features, and finally extracts rich temporal dynamic features. In order to make full use of video semantic information, semantically embedded GRU and X-Linear are used as decoders to generate video descriptions. To prevent over-fitting, layer normalization and variational Dropout are used for the GRU of the decoder.The proposed algorithm only uses video frame features, and has achieved good results on the public video description data set MSVD.
Key words : video caption;semantic embedding;X-Linear attention;XLSNet

0 引言

         視頻描述任務是將計算機視覺信息轉換為人類能夠理解的自然語言句子的描述。將計算機視覺內容理解和自然語言處理兩個領域相結合用于解決視頻描述是一項極具挑戰(zhàn)性的任務。視頻描述涉及對許多實體的理解,這些實體包括場景、人物、物體、人的動作、人與物體的交互、人與人的交互、其他事件以及事件發(fā)生的順序等。所有這些信息必須使用自然語言處理(Natural Language Processing,NLP)技術,以一種可壓縮的、語法正確的文本表達出來。視頻描述任務可以應用于很多領域,如智能安防、盲人導航、視頻檢索、人機交互等。




本文詳細內容請下載:http://theprogrammingfactory.com/resource/share/2000003378




作者信息:

李亞杰,關勝曉,倪長好

(中國科學技術大學 微電子學院,安徽 合肥230026)

此內容為AET網站原創(chuàng),未經授權禁止轉載。